American vs. European Roulette: A Crucial Choice
One of the most important decisions an American roulette player can make is choosing which variant to play. The American wheel features a 0 and a 00, which gives the house a significant edge of 5.26 percent. The European wheel, with its single 0, reduces this edge to just 2.70 percent. This difference dramatically impacts your long-term bankroll.
While the American wheel is a nostalgic staple found in brick-and-mortar casinos across the country, savvy players often seek out European roulette for better odds. Many online platforms now offer both versions, allowing you to choose based on your mood or strategy.

Understanding Roulette Variants
The most critical decision you’ll make is which variant to play. American roulette features a wheel with 38 pockets, including a double zero, giving the house a 5.26% edge. European roulette, by contrast, has 37 pockets and a single zero, reducing the house edge to 2.70%. French roulette offers the same wheel as European but adds two special rules – La Partage and En Prison – that can cut the house edge in half on even-money bets.
For US players, American roulette is the most familiar version, found in casinos from Reno to Biloxi. However, online operators in regulated states increasingly offer European and French variants because players recognize the better odds. If you are new to the game, start with European roulette to stretch your bankroll. Seasoned players often gravitate toward French roulette when available, especially for outside bets.
The Importance of House Edge and RTP
House edge directly affects how much you can expect to lose over time. A lower house edge means your money lasts longer. European roulette’s 2.70% edge translates to a theoretical return-to-player (RTP) of 97.30%, while American roulette’s RTP is only 94.74%. Over a long session, that difference adds up.
Many US online casinos display the RTP for each game in the help menu or game description. Always check this figure before placing real money bets. Some tables also offer “no zero” or “zero-less” variants, but these are rare and often come with other restrictions. Stick to the classic versions with proven RTP numbers. A table with a higher RTP is almost always a better choice for your wallet.
Betting Limits and Your Bankroll
Every roulette table has minimum and maximum bet limits. Low-limit tables may start at $0.10 or $0.50 per spin, making them ideal for casual players or those testing a new strategy. High-limit tables can go up to $10,000 or more per bet, catering to high rollers who want action without capping their wagers.
Match the table limits to your bankroll size. A good rule of thumb is to have at least 50 times the minimum bet for outside bets, and more if you plan to play inside numbers. For example, if you have a $100 bankroll, look for a table with a $1 minimum. Avoid tables where the minimum is more than 2% of your total funds, as that forces you into risky betting patterns. US-friendly casinos often let you filter tables by limit, so use that feature to narrow your search.

What Is a Corner Bet in Roulette
A corner bet, sometimes called a square bet or quarter bet, is placed at the intersection of four numbers on the roulette layout. On a standard European wheel, for example, you might cover 1, 2, 4, and 5 by putting your chip on the cross where those four squares meet. The bet wins if the ball lands on any of those four numbers.
This wager belongs to the category of inside bets, meaning it offers higher payouts than red/black or odd/even bets but carries a lower probability of winning. The corner bet online works exactly the same way in digital and live dealer versions, making it a versatile option for players who want more control over which numbers they cover.
How the Corner Bet Works in Online Roulette
Placing a corner bet on an online roulette table is straightforward. You select your chip value, then click or tap the intersection point of four numbers. Most online interfaces highlight the covered numbers so you can see exactly what you are betting on. You can place multiple corner bets on the same spin to cover larger sections of the wheel.
In American roulette, the layout includes a double zero, which shifts the odds slightly compared to European roulette. The corner bet still pays 8 to 1, but the house edge increases from 2.70% on a single-zero wheel to 5.26% on a double-zero wheel. Many US online casinos offer both variants, so you can choose the version that best fits your strategy.
Comparing Corner Bet Payouts and Odds
Understanding how the corner bet stacks up against other wagers helps you make informed decisions. The table below compares the payout and probability for common inside bets on a European roulette wheel.
Bet Type Payout Probability (European) House Edge Straight up 35:1 2.70% 2.70% Split 17:1 5.41% 2.70% Street 11:1 8.11% 2.70% Corner 8:1 10.81% 2.70% Six line 5:1 16.22% 2.70% The corner bet hits more frequently than a straight-up or split bet while still offering a respectable payout. When playing American roulette, the probabilities shift slightly because of the extra zero. Here is a comparison for the double-zero wheel.
Bet Type Payout Probability (American) House Edge Straight up 35:1 2.63% 5.26% Split 17:1 5.26% 5.26% Street 11:1 7.89% 5.26% Corner 8:1 10.53% 5.26% Six line 5:1 15.79% 5.26% The house edge remains consistent across inside bets on the same wheel, but the corner bet’s higher hit rate makes it a favorite among players who want to see wins more often without sacrificing too much payout potential.

What Is Multiball Roulette?
Multiball roulette is a variation in which the dealer (or the automated system in digital versions) releases two or more balls onto the spinning wheel. Each ball lands in a separate pocket, so multiple numbers win on every spin. The most common versions use two balls, but some tables offer three or even four balls. The core rules of roulette remain unchanged: you place bets on numbers, colors, or groups, and you win if any of the balls land on your selection.
The key difference is that your odds of winning increase because multiple outcomes occur per round. However, payouts are adjusted to account for the higher probability. For example, a straight-up bet on a single number might pay less than the standard 35-to-1 if two balls are in play, but the chance of hitting that number at least once is doubled. This trade-off appeals to players who prefer frequent wins over massive payouts.

Differences Between Multiball and Standard Roulette
To help you decide which version suits your style, here is a straightforward comparison of key features.
Feature Standard Roulette Multiball Roulette Number of balls 1 2 or more (usually 2) Winning outcomes per spin 1 2 or more Odds of hitting a single number 1 in 37 (European) or 1 in 38 (American) Approximately 2 in 37 or 2 in 38 Payout for straight-up bet 35:1 Typically 17:1 (for 2-ball version) Speed of play Moderate Faster (more results per hour) House edge 2.70% (European) / 5.26% (American) Same as standard for the underlying wheel type The house edge remains identical because the payouts are mathematically adjusted. For example, in a double-ball European roulette game, the true odds of a specific number hitting are 2 in 37, so a fair payout would be 17.5:1. Casinos round down to 17:1, preserving the same 2.70% edge. US players should always check whether the game uses a single-zero or double-zero wheel, as the American version has a higher built-in advantage.
